Subject: Quickstore 4.2 — bloom filter now fronts the KV layer

Plugin authors: starting with this release, Quickstore places a bloom filter ahead of the key-value store. Negative lookups return faster; false positives fall through safely. No API changes are required on your side. Verify your plugin against the staging build referenced below.

session token of fahif-tadup = htk3_9c7

All report exports from the Caldora scheduler are generated in UTC, then shifted to the workspace timezone at render time. Do not convert earlier in the pipeline; the Veltmark archive expects UTC rows. DST edges are handled by the tzshift helper, not manually. To pull reference exports from the internal fixtures service, authenticate with the key shown below.

API key for yahig-tadup: kto7_ubizbYm

## Formula sandbox tuning

User-supplied formulas in Gridmoor execute inside a restricted interpreter with hard ceilings on time, memory, and call depth. Reviewers should confirm any change to these ceilings is justified in the PR description, since raising them widens the abuse surface. Defaults were chosen from production traces. The current limits are as follows.

limits module of tafog-fawip:
WEIGHTS = {
    "julix": 57,
    "lamys": 992,
    "kasvan": 209,
    "quenok": 750,
    "alddor": 259,
    "oliath": 1009,
    "wenix": 815,
}